Queen of Cream is nearing the arrival of its first brick-and-mortar ice cream parlor with a grand opening set for Thursday, August 13, the company this week announced in a press release.

The Old Fourth Ward dessert shop, at 701 Highland Avenue NE. in space formerly occupied by Fruttela, will serve up “traditional parlor goods” like ice cream, sundaes, milkshakes, floats, and coffee.

Queen of Cream was co-founded by 28-year-old Cora Cotrim, previously the pastry chef for Paper Plane, Victory Sandwich Bar, and Cacao. Cotrim in 2014 started the company with her partner Davis Sandling, who oversees business operations and sales.

Cora makes small batches of ice cream using local and organic ingredients, and she pasteurizes Queen of Cream’s frozen confections in-house. The company sources grass-fed, organic milk from Working Cows Dairy (Slocomb, AL) and cream from Southern Swiss Dairy (Waynesboro, GA).

The parlor will be open all day and offer over a dozen ice cream flavors by the scoop, as well as retail pints to-go. While the menu will rotate frequently, recent varieties have included Sweet GA Corn + Blueberries, Fresh Mint Chip, Thai Tea, Cold-Brew Coffee with Cacao Nibs, Brown Butter Whiskey Pecan, Cornflake Bacon Brittle, and Pretzel with Chocolate Covered Pretzels + Peanut Butter Caramel.

Queen of Cream’s brick-and-mortar location will feature a full bakery offering pies, cookies, and more, according to the release. The shop will also feature a full coffee program, including pour over, espresso, cold brew, and nitro coffee on draft.

Queen of Cream’s mobile ice cream cart will continue operation and is available for rent for private events.
